The HIPS in Saarbrücken was founded jointly by the Helmholtz Centre for Infection Research (HZI) and Saarland University as the first German research institute explicitly dedicated to pharmaceutical research in 2009. Scientists at HIPS develop and employ experimental and computational techniques to provide new active substances against infectious diseases, optimise them for use in humans and investigate how they can best be transported to their site of action in the human body. A special focus of the institute is on microbial natural products from soil bacteria and the human microbiota including their mode of action and production as well as innovative medicinal chemistry-driven approaches. HIPS is currently undergoing both a thematic and spatial expansion and is expected to grow to around 330 employees within the coming years.
Researchers in the department Microbial Natural Products are aiming to identify, investigate and optimize novel natural product based actives, applying diverse approaches and methods mainly from the fields of biotechnology, microbiology, molecular biology and biochemistry. A major research focus of the department is the genetic engineering of microbial natural product producing microorganisms to enhance product diversity and yield. To this end, we develop and apply innovative molecular biology- based tools.
